As prescribed in 436.575, insert the following clause:
Maximum Workweek—Construction Schedule (NOV 1996)
Within __ calendar days after receipt of a written request from the Contracting Officer, the Contractor must submit the following in writing for approval:
(a) A schedule as required by FAR clause 52.236–15, Schedules for Construction Contracts, and
(b) The hours (including the daily starting and stopping times) and days of the week the Contractor proposes to carry out the work.
The maximum workweek that will be approved is ___*.
(End of clause)
*Contracting Officer shall insert appropriate number of days and hours and/or days.
